- (OBIT: Mrs. Bessie Noyes was born at Rush City, April 24, 1906, and had made her residence in this community all her life. She attended the Rush City Schools, graduating from the Rush City High School.
She was united in marriage to Alanson Noyes in 1937 . To this union born two children, Russell and Royland.
Mrs. Noyes leaves to mourn her unimely passing the two sons above mentioned, her husband, Alanson, her father and step-mother, Mr. and Mrs. Walter Norris, one sister, Bernice, and two brothers, Eugene and Henry, and one half brother, James.
Mrs. Noyes passed away at Ah-Gwah-Ching, April 20, 1937. At her death she was 30 years, 11 months, and 27 days of age. Funeral services were held Friday, April 23, at 1 o'clock p.m., from the Chapel in Rush City, Rev H.G. Courtly officiating. Mrs. Leslie Ogren and Mrs. Clayton Moulton, rendered duets, accompanied by Mrs. Paul Ebert. The pallbearers were Arvid Carlson, Sigfred Swanson, Joe Swanson, Jr., George Jaffrey, Leo Bendickson and Henry Bendickson.
Interment was had in the family lot in the Indian Cemetery near Randall, Wisconsin. The Chapel was filled with friends, relatives and neighbors of the deceased. The floral tributes were many and beautiful.)
